ro•man•ti•cize



Pronunciation: (rō-man'tu-sīz"), [key]
v., -cized, -ciz•ing.


v.t.
to make romantic; invest with a romantic character: Many people romanticize the role of an editor.

v.i.
to hold romantic notions, ideas, etc. Also, esp. Brit.,ro•man'ti•cise".
